Brain Evolution in the Human Species

Brain maturation in the kind-hearted Species Introduction hominid exploitation is marked by a very solid addition in relative consciousness size. Because relative star size has been tie in to strenuous requirements, it is thinkable to look at the form of encephalization as a instrument in the maturation of merciful grass and fasting (Foley et al., 1991). major intricacy of the understanding is associated with the homophile species sort of than the Hominidae as a whole, where the energetic costs atomic number 18 likely to bring forth forced file name extension of harvesting rate and secondary altriciality (Foley et al., 1991). paleontological evidence indicates that rapid head teacher developing occurred with the emergence of Homo erectus 1.8 million years ago and was associated with meaning(a) changes in diet, corpse size, and foraging deportment (Leonard et al., 2007). Energy Requirements abundant energy is necessitate for caput growth and func tioning. Parker (1990) break ups intelligence and encephalization from the post of life narrative strategy theory, which is ground on the preface that evolutionary endurance determines the timing of major life roll events-especially those related to re harvest-timeion-as the dissolvent to energy optimisation problems. Foley and Lee (1991) analyze the evolutionary pattern of encephalization with respect to foraging and dieting strategies. In considering the development of humankind foraging strategies, increase re pulls for foraging driving force and food affect whitethorn be an all important(p) requisite for encephalization, and in turn a double adept is unavoidable to organize human foraging behavior. dietetical quality is overly tally with witticism size. Foley and Lee (1991) first base consider header size vs. hierarch feeding strategies, and short letter that folivorous diets (leaves) ar jibe with smaller brains, enchantment fruit and brute foods ( insects, meat) are correlated with epicr brains. Overall, the transmissible costs of brain maintenance for new-made humans are about common chord times that of a chimpanzee. The first dietary carrier bag is seen head start at bottom the genus Homo, which began to complicate meat in the diet. It may be argued that meat-eating represents an expansion of resource pretentiousness beyond that arrange in non-human coiffe Primates (Foley and Lee, 1991). Therefore, Homo and its encephalization may set out been the product of the selection of receptive of exploiting energy- and protein-rich resources as the habitat expanded. While the evolutionary causes of the enlarging human brain themselves are thinking to have been payable to factors that go beyond diet just (increasing social system of rules universe gear up among the proposed factors usually cited), a diet of decent quality would so far have been an important prerequisite. That is, diet would have been an important hurdle, or limiting factor, to bruise in providing the required physiological understructure for brain elaborateness to occur within the context of whatsoever those other basal selective pressures world power have been. Leonard and Robinson (1994 append page metrical composition for direct quote) shut down These results imply that changes in diet quality during hominid evolution were linked with the evolution of brain size. The shift to a much calorically dense diet was probably undeniable in order to substantially increase the amount of metabolous energy being used by the hominid brain. Thus, while nutritional factors totally are non sufficient to justify the evolution of our large brains, it seems clear that authorized dietary changes were incumbent for substantial brain evolution to throw place.

The story of DDT and Malaria (History Essay) Essay - 1

The story of DDT and Malaria (History ) - Essay ExampleAt the end of World War II the technological advancements that were a product of the war began to click into the commercial economy. The growing demand for food brought about the need for chemicals to grow, preserve, and package food products as agriculture moved from the family farm and into large-scale operations. This era witnessed the presentation of DDT at a time when its long-term effects were unknown, and in 1950 the US House of Representatives opened hearings to investigate the use of chemicals and additives to food products.3 In 1962 Rachel Carson wrote her confines book Silent Spring, which brought about public scrutiny in regards to the safety of the fertilizer, insecticide, and pesticide programs that were being used in domestic agriculture. Since that time the US has escalated their drive to supervise the use of chemicals in the food chain and have maintained a policy of the evaluation and licensing the use of haz ardous chemicals with the goal of creating safer consumer products. While this policy has brought thousands of products chthonian the scrutiny of the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), DDT was one of the first and most visible victims of this program.During the 1950s the World Health Organization (WHO) pursued a policy of widespread use of DDT in Asia, Latin America, and Africa in an effort to eliminate the mosquitoes that transmitted the deadly disease of malaria. By 1971 the WHO estimated that as more as 1 billion people had been freed from the risk on contracting malaria.4 However, there were dangers lurking in the shadows of this success. Because there was a chance of the insects building up a resistance to DDT over time, it was necessary to spray the infected areas on a regular and diligent schedule. Corportions Law in Australia - Essay ExampleA Company is a distinct legal entity whereas a coalition firm in not distinct from the several psyches who compose it (The ICFAI University, 2005). When it comes to issue of liability, a partners liability is always un check whereas that of shareholder may be control either by shares or by guarantee. The main difference between a partnership and a limited company is that the liability of a companys shareholders is limited to the count of the unpaid amount on the shares that they own2 (Complete Business Services Ltd). Partners on the other hand, can not restrict their liability i.e. as they have an unfathomable liability and therefore can be held personally responsible for any unpaid debts the partnership incurs.In a partnership firm, partners are joint and apiece liable for partnership debts. Thus if one partner engages in an activity which results in large debts, all partners, regardless of whether or not they had prior friendship o f the activities would be equally liable to make good any shortfall in funds from their personal assets. But this is not the case with a company. As discussed earlier, the liability of the participants in a company is limited to the amount of shares that are held by them in the company.The case of Salomon vs. Salomon & Co. Ltd., took place in the year 1879. ... y purchased the care of Salomon for 39,000, and the purchase consideration was paid in terms of debentures worth 10,000 conferring a charge over the companys assets, and 20,000 shares of 1 each fully paid-up and the balance amount in cash. The company in less than one year ran into difficulties and liquidation proceedings commenced. The assets of the company were not even sufficient to discharge the debentures and postcode was leftover for the unsecured creditors. The unsecured creditors contended that though incorporated under the Act, the company never had an independent existence it was in fact an alter-ego of Salomon, the other directors being his sons under his control. It was held by the House of Lords that the company had been validly constituted since the Act only required seven members holding at least one share each. It said that nothing about their being independent, or that there should be anything like a balance of power in the constitution of the company3 (Ask Me Help Desk). The company is different person at law and though it may be that after incorporation the business is precisely the same as before, the same persons are managers, and the same work force receive the profits, the company is not, in law their agent or trustee. Hence, the business belonged to the company and not to Salomon.The court observed that the company was a separate person, a separate body altogether different from the shareholders and the transfer was as much as conveyance, a transfer of property, as if the shareholders had been totally different persons. It can be seen from the proceedings of the above discuss ed case that a company is given a distinct legal entity in comparison to the individuals who are managing the affairs of the company. Native American Culture - Essay ExampleVocals were very important and were the guts of the Native American medicament (Pritzker, 1998). Singing and percussion was crucial and songs ranged from solo to responsorial and multipart singing (Barreiro, Akwe kon Press. & National Museum of the American Indian ,2004). Music was mainly done by groups of people and hence there was no musical harmony and the rhythms were irregular. The people who sang songs were very passionate and spiritual and when they sang, they did it to involve spirits, make rain or heal the sick. Music form different tribes differed in terms of vocals and dancing styles. A common characteristic in all Native American music is that while dancing, men danced round in circles while the women danced in one place. Native American music is very intricate and complex due to the have vocals and varying sounds from drums and flutes. The music began at a lower note and gradually grew faster and more emphatic both in vocals and sounds from the musical instruments. The natives were from very some tribes ad each tribe had a unique dancing style and hence the Native American culture in music is so rich. Tribes such as the Eskimos produced simple music and simple dancing styles while other tribes such as the Zuni and Hopi are characterized with very complex music comprising of different vocals and legion(predicate) dancing styles. The Native American music has not been replicated in the modern music, but the folk dances of the present day resemble those of the past.Music played a vital role in the Native American communities was simply unavoidable (Barreiro, Akwe kon Press. & National Museum of the American Indian ,2004). Music was played for historical purposes, for education and for transient of information from one generation to another. Transfusion in the patient with Sickle cell Disease - evidence Examplee, transfusion strategy is applied to prevent the recurrence, or the first occurrence, of stroke which is a major crisis in SCD, and to manage pulmonary hypertension and new(prenominal) sources of morbidity and mortality. Exchange transfusions are used to reduce the sickle cell haemoglobin (HbS) levels during crisis. Several situations also exist wherein the indication for red cell transfusion is controversial, uncertain, or downright injudicious. Many side effects of transfusion have been identified and methods to overcome them have been developed. Iron overload (remedy iron chelation), and alloimmunisation (remedy phenotypical matching of transfused blood) are two notable examples. Association of haemoglobinopathies and neurologic sequelae after transfusion is also known. At the present time, bone marrow transplant is the nevertheless redress procedure available for both SCD and -thalassaemia major. Potenti al therapies involving stem cell transplantation and gene techniques are being vigorously researched.A detailed intelligence of the current status of clinical management strategies as applied to inherited haemoglobin-related diseases in particular, sickle cell disease and the thalassaemias, is presented in this paper.Anaemia is a syndrome characterised by a lack of healthy red blood cells or haemoglobin deficiency in the red blood cells, resulting in inadequate oxygen supply to the tissues. The condition can be temporary, long-term or chronic, and of mild to severe intensity. There are many forms and causes of anaemia. Normal blood consists of three types of blood cells fair blood cells (leucocytes), platelets and red blood cells (erythrocytes). The first generation of erythrocyte precursors in the developing foetus are produced in the yolk sac. They are carried to the developing colorful by the blood where they form mature red blood cells that are required to meet the metabolic needs of the foetus. Mergers and Joint Ventures EssayWhen a friendship is first born, the last thing on its owners mind is coming together with another company. A conjugation is sometimes a voluntary and sometimes and involuntary transaction. If a company has found itself in a place of financial difficult or is simply exhausted all its resources to remain open, a merger may be the only way its employees can retain their position. The utility(a) would be to close its doors and give up. Below we will discuss the distinctions between horizontal, erect, and conglomerate mergers and how these differ from a joint jeopardize. Horizontal mergers occur between businesses at bottom the same industry. Often between organizations that share the same space or sell similar competing goods or services. A horizontal merger is simply frame two companies who consolidate to work as one to make the goods or services better or more profitably. A good example would be when Hewlett Packard and Compaq merged. Two rival competitors selling similar goods who merged together to continue making products as a team.According to the Minority Business Development Agency, a vertical merger occurs when two or more firms, operating at different levels within an industrys cede chain, merge operations. The idea behind a vertical merger is synergy. When two companies that are not necessarily selling the same type of product or products, but are in the same supply chain merge together to make a more efficient company is synergy. One example of a vertical merger would be if American Airlines merged with Boeing manufacturing company.This would cut out the tenderness man between American and Boeing, and give American more control of the process, versus having to go through a middle man. Conglomeration mergers are mergers between two companies that have nothing in common. Usually these two companies merge to diversify their holdings. An example of a conglomeration merger would belike a company that makes ic e cream merging with a company that owns grocery stores. Although the two companies are different, one can uphold the other and thus make a profit for both of the companies.The difference between a conglomeration merger and a joint venture is that a joint venture can be entered into by any two companies working separately from their original purpose on a joint jutting that will produce a profit for both companies. The companies agreeing to a joint venture do not necessarily have to change their original company structure or management. The original company may be a different entity entirely. Joint ventures enable companies to diversify.All of these mergers are example of companies that joined forces, and either one or both disregarded their individual identity. A joint venture in comparison is when a commercial enterprise is undertaken jointly by two or more parties, while maintaining their individual identities. This could be when a cable company and phone company create a joint venture to offer their customers services yet have all their bills on one tab. This makes it easier for companies to offer discounts for bundling services and makes it easy on the customer because they can go to one place rather than several places for different products.Referenceshttp//www.investopedia.com/terms/h/horizontalmerger.aspMinority business development agency, U.S. Department of Commerce, (n.d.), Retrieved from http//www.mbda.gov/node/1409 N.
